This is a list of games to play with people who might like Risk. Essentially it a list of "The Best Light Wargames for 3 or more Players", and I actually renamed it from that.
Most of the games on this list are sourced from my previous geeklist, Ultimate Light Wargame Battle! but feel free to add any games that you think belong here.
To qualify for the list games have to be "Best with" or "Recommended with" 3 or more players and have to have a category of "Wargame".
Update: Now sorted by the combined rating, giving points for the rank compared with other games on this list for BGG Rating, BGG Ranking and #Plays. A penalty is given if the game is not "Best With" 3 or more players and a bonus is given if the game is Print 'n' Play (because of cheapness & availability).

npetry: "I have played Wallenstein many times now, and the game remains a solid 10 for me. This game is superb -- it is a bit longer than most of the games I play (~3 hrs), but it is completely engrossing for the duration. The game uses a variety of novel mechanisms that provide _controlled_ randomness, leading to many interesting decisions. Among these, the battle tower is a standout -- it provides a quick and amusing way to resolve combat, and since unused armies remain lodged in the tower for future battles, players' luck tends to average out much better than dice. Overall, a stunning game from a master designer!"

kamchatka: "Sometimes I feel like this game's most boring and tireless promoter. It's a great empire-building game with a perfect balance of depth and ease of play; it can run a little long for some people, but the downtime is interesting enough, particularly with 5-6 players. Some people think the most original element of this game is the alliance mechanism, in which you bid over who you're allowed to attack. Personally, I think the best thing about Struggle of Empires is that while it doesn't have too terribly many measurements of success to keep track of, it has a wide range of tiles that allow you to really customize your strategy. There is no single obvious route to victory."
